The Covert Threats of Refractive Surgical Treatment
While many people look for refractive surgical treatment for clearer vision, it's vital to comprehend the surprise risks included.
You could experience complications like dry eyes, glare, or halos around lights, which can impact your day-to-day activities. There's likewise a possibility that your vision won't boost as anticipated, or it can also get worse.
Some clients report discontentment, leading to the requirement for glasses or contact lenses once more. In rare cases, more serious issues may develop, such as infection or corneal scarring.

Realistic Expectations: Results and Limitations
Adhering to refractive surgery, it is very important to understand what you can realistically expect concerning your vision results. Several patients accomplish 20/25 vision or far better, yet perfect sight isn't assured. Some could still require glasses for details tasks, like analysis or driving at night.
It's crucial to have sensible assumptions concerning the capacity for small vision variations during the healing process.
In addition, numerous elements such as age, pre-existing problems, and the type of surgical procedure can influence your results. While problems are unusual, they can take place, so discussing these threats with your doctor is important.
